    I purchased thread to match a rag quilt I am making for my DGD. I am now ready to start sewing the squares together and I just noticed it is 30 wt thread. Will this be strong enough to hold the rag quilt together or do I need to head for Joann's to get 50 wt?

    30 wt thread is heavier than 50 wt thread, so you should be just fine. :D:D:D

    with thread, the lower the number, the thicker the thread.
